Floor & Decor-Roswell Celebrates Fourth of July
Categories: Blog
The newly opened Floor & Decor store in Roswell marked the Fourth of July holiday the same as you and I, with plenty of food and patriotic activities all weekend long. Proving its much more than a home-improvement store, Floor & Decor-Roswell employees invited the local community to participate in a wide variety of celebrations at its location including:
- a bake sale to benefit a colleague who has cancer
- parade float decorating for the Fourth of July Steam Engine Parade in Cumming
- a live broadcast of the “Moby in the Morning” radio show
- a pie-eating contest
- kids crafts
- eating hot dogs and brats, Rita’s Italian ice and cotton candy
- contributions for Operation Shoebox, which sends toiletries, magazines, non-perishable food items and more to our troops overseas
- pet adoptions
- meeting Uncle Sam and Lady Liberty
